#450670 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#450670 is composed of 27.1% red, 2.4% green and 43.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 38.4% cyan, 94.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 275.7 degrees, a saturation of 89.8% and a lightness of 23.1%. #450670 color hex could be obtained by blending #8a0ce0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#450670 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#450670 has RGB values of R:69, G:6, B:112 and CMYK values of C:0.38,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 4523632.
